Ive had my z almost 2 years now, and in the last week I noticed that i will be driving and at RANDOM points the dome lights in the car will turn on by themselves like my car is possessed......its happened 5 times between las friday and today randomly. I have to literally turn the switch from "door" to "off" and then a couple mins later if i turn it to "door" they are off. Very strange. I havent done anything to my car in a year in terms of even the slightest mod

Possibly the body control module (BCM). The dealer should know about this but if not tell them to check the bulletin for it. I have seen this a few times and it was always the BCM.

The BCM is located behind the driver's kick panel. (To the left of the dead pedal) It controls pretty much everything inside the car. If that is the problem make sure you have all your keys and remotes with the car because they will have to reprogrammed.
